The City of Springfield and Lane County Planning Commissions held a joint meeting on March 17, 2026, to discuss amendments to the Glenwood Refinement Plan and Springfield Development Code, focusing on climate friendly areas and the proposed Eugene Water and Electric Board (EWEB) Wamtt River water treatment plant project. The meeting included a work session and a public hearing where staff presented the draft plan and code amendments aimed at designating Glenwood as a primary climate friendly area with high-density mixed-use zoning to meet housing needs and state greenhouse gas reduction targets. A significant portion of the discussion centered on permitting high impact public utility facilities, specifically to enable the construction of the new water treatment plant by EWEB. The amendments would allow this facility as a permitted use in the Glenwood employment mixed-use zone, with environmental and design standards to minimize impacts. Commissioners asked questions about density requirements, parking standards, and the project's environmental and community benefits. Public testimony supported the project, emphasizing its importance for regional water resiliency. The commissions were set to consider recommendations for approval, with the amendments facilitating future detailed land use and environmental reviews for the treatment plant project.
